Dataset: honeycomb.dat Source: R.R. Butukuri, V.P. Bheemreddy, K. Chandashekhara, and V.A. Samaranayake (2012). "Evaluation of Low-Velocity Impact Response of Honeycomb Sandwich Structures Using Factorial-Based Design of Experiments, Journal of Sandwich Structures and Materials, 14(3), pp. 339-361. Description: 3^3 Factorial measuring 3 responses at 3 levels of 3 factors in 54 runs (2 reps ate each of 27 combinations of factors). Factor A: Angle Difference Between Successive Prepreg Layers -1=30, 0=45, +1=60 Factor B: Number of Prepreg Layers -1-4, 0=8, +1=12 Factor C: Number of Adhesive Layers -1=1, 0=2, +1=3 Response X = Energy Absorbed (Joulles) Response Y = Peak Contact Load (kN) Response Z = Maximum Deflection (mm) Variables/Columns Sample # 7-8 Coded Factor A 15-16 Coded Factor B 23-24 Coded factor C 31-32 Energy Absorbed 34-40 Peak Contact Load 42-48 Max deflection 50-56
